Regent's University London is a private, not-for-profit higher education college located in London, United Kingdom. It is one of only six private colleges in the United Kingdom to have been granted taught degree awarding powers.

Regent's University has its campus in Regent's Park, central London. It is one of the two largest groups of buildings in the park, along with the London Zoo, and was built on the site of South Villa, one of the original eight Regent's Park villas.
